2. Plan Your Itinerary

Once you've gathered enough information, it's time to plan your itinerary. Guangzhou offers a diverse array of experiences, from historical sites and modern architecture to lush green parks and vibrant markets. Here's a sample itinerary to get you started:

Day 1: Explore the bustling streets of Liwan District, visit the Chen Clan Ancestral Hall, and sample local street food.

Day 2: Discover the historic sites of Guangzhou, such as the Sun Yat-sen Memorial Hall and the Temple of the Six Banyan Trees.

Day 3: Indulge in Guangzhou's rich culinary scene by visiting the Xiguan Historical District and sampling traditional Cantonese cuisine.

Day 4: Immerse yourself in the city's modern culture by visiting the Canton Tower and exploring the nearby Tianhe District.

Day 5: Take a day trip to nearby cultural landmarks, such as the Baiyun Mountain or the Beijiao Ancient Town.

3. Stay in Style

Your choice of accommodation can greatly enhance your Guangzhou travel experience. From luxury hotels to cozy guesthouses, there's something for every budget and preference. Consider staying in areas like Tianhe District, which offers easy access to popular attractions and dining options.

4. Savor the Local Cuisine

One of Guangzhou's most famous claims to fame is its culinary scene. Don't miss the chance to indulge in authentic Cantonese cuisine, including dim sum, roasted goose, and sweet and sour pork. Here are a few must-try restaurants:
